Abstract
A new fluorimetric method for the determination of epinephrine is established by rare earth co-luminescence effect of Tb-Gd-E-Tris system. Under optimum conditions, a linear relationship has been obtained between the fluorescence intensity and the concentration of epinephrine in the range of 1.8Â ÃÂ 10â8 to 2.5Â ÃÂ 10â6Â mol/l, and the detection limit is 4.5Â ÃÂ 10â9Â mol/l (S/NÂ =Â 3). The method is applied for the determination of epinephrine in injection and the recovery test in urine by standard addition method, and the results obtained are satisfactory. The mechanism of the co-luminescence in the system was also discussed.
